互联网加竞赛 机器视觉opencv答题卡识别系统

02-28 2046阅读 0评论

0 前言

🔥 优质竞赛项目系列,今天要分享的是

互联网加竞赛 机器视觉opencv答题卡识别系统,互联网加竞赛 机器视觉opencv答题卡识别系统,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第1张
(图片来源网络,侵删)

🚩 答题卡识别系统 - opencv python 图像识别

该项目较为新颖,适合作为竞赛课题方向,学长非常推荐!

🥇学长这里给一个题目综合评分(每项满分5分)

  • 难度系数:3分
  • 工作量:3分
  • 创新点:3分

    🧿 更多资料, 项目分享:

    https://gitee.com/dancheng-senior/postgraduate

    什么是机器视觉

    答题卡识别使用的是机器视觉识别算法, 那什么是机器视觉算法呢?

    互联网加竞赛 机器视觉opencv答题卡识别系统,互联网加竞赛 机器视觉opencv答题卡识别系统,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第2张
    (图片来源网络,侵删)

    机器视觉,并不是视觉,他不具有人类的视觉理解能力,说穿了他只是图像处理技术的工程应用,都是由工程师开发的算法来完成任务,并且是特定的算法完成特定的任务,互相之间没有通用性。

    废话不多说, 学长到大家看看, 这项技术实现的效果如何.

    实现步骤

    答题卡识别步骤:

    • Step #1: 检测到图片中的答题卡
    • Step #2: 应用透视变换来提取图中的答题卡(以自上向下的鸟瞰视图)
    • Step #3: 从透视变换后的答题卡中提取 the set of 气泡/圆点 (答案选项)
    • Step #4: 将题目/气泡排序成行
    • Step #5: 判断每行中被标记/涂的答案
    • Step #6: 在我们的答案字典中查找正确的答案来判断答题是否正确
    • Step #7: 为其它题目重复上述操作

      首先,打开摄像头扫描答题卡

      互联网加竞赛 机器视觉opencv答题卡识别系统,在这里插入图片描述,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第3张

      对摄像头获取到的答题卡图片进行二值化腐蚀膨胀边缘检测

      互联网加竞赛 机器视觉opencv答题卡识别系统,互联网加竞赛 机器视觉opencv答题卡识别系统,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第4张
      (图片来源网络,侵删)

      互联网加竞赛 机器视觉opencv答题卡识别系统,在这里插入图片描述,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第5张

      轮廓计算,进行顶点对齐,得到下图

      互联网加竞赛 机器视觉opencv答题卡识别系统,在这里插入图片描述,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第6张

      对图像进行倾斜变换和仿射变换,得到下图

      互联网加竞赛 机器视觉opencv答题卡识别系统,在这里插入图片描述,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第7张

      开始对图像进行二值化,边缘检测等操作,最终得到结果

      互联网加竞赛 机器视觉opencv答题卡识别系统,在这里插入图片描述,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第8张

      互联网加竞赛 机器视觉opencv答题卡识别系统,在这里插入图片描述,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第9张

      互联网加竞赛 机器视觉opencv答题卡识别系统,在这里插入图片描述,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第10张

      互联网加竞赛 机器视觉opencv答题卡识别系统,在这里插入图片描述,词库加载错误:未能找到文件“C:\Users\Administrator\Desktop\火车头9.8破解版\Configuration\Dict_Stopwords.txt”。,使用,互联网,操作,第11张

      最后

      🧿 更多资料, 项目分享:

      https://gitee.com/dancheng-senior/postgraduate


免责声明
本网站所收集的部分公开资料来源于AI生成和互联网,转载的目的在于传递更多信息及用于网络分享,并不代表本站赞同其观点和对其真实性负责,也不构成任何其他建议。
文章版权声明:除非注明,否则均为主机测评原创文章,转载或复制请以超链接形式并注明出处。

发表评论

快捷回复: 表情:
评论列表 (暂无评论,2046人围观)

还没有评论,来说两句吧...

目录[+]